The Repositories/Health Data Repository (HDR) system encompasses a relational database, HDR Database (HDR DB), as well as Simple Object Access Protocol (SOAP) and Representational State Transfer (REST) standards-based web service interfaces for retrieving data from HDR DB or Veterans Health Information Systems and Technology Architecture (VistA) or both HDR DB and VistA any time from within the Department of Veterans Affairs (VA) intranet. The system also includes asynchronous Java Messaging Service (JMS) interfaces for storage of data to the HDR Database any time from within the VA intranet. The web services enable VistA federation and data aggregation when data is retrieved from VistA.
Repositories services include Clinical Data Service (CDS), Pathways, Aggregate Read Service (ARS), and the Federated Patient Data Service (FPDS). The services support accepting an optional Secure Assertion Markup Language 2.0 (SAML 2.0) token on the SOAP headers for SOAP services and Hyper Text Transfer Protocol (HTTP) headers for REST services. This functionality is ready for deployment when VistA foundation is complete. All services are based on a Java Enterprise Edition (Java EE) framework and differ mainly in the data domains and exchange formats supported. CDS, Pathways, ARS and FPDS support Extensible Markup Language (XML) for data interchange. In addition to XML, FPDS also supports JavaScript Object Notation (JSON) for data interchange. JMS interfaces accept payload in Health Level Seven (HL7) format from CDS Socket Adapter and the VistA Interface Engine (VIE).
The service framework has been enhanced to support integrations with Enterprise Messaging Infrastructure (eMI) and includes integration with the eMI WebSphere Service Registry and Repository (WSRR) services and eMI messaging and routing services. The eMI WSRR service provides web service endpoint resolution to the HDR framework and replaced internally deployed Universal Description and Discovery Integration (UDDI) services. The eMI provides message routing capabilities as part of its Enterprise Service Bus (ESB) service that routes messages destined for the HDR to HDR service interfaces. Once all the VistA Data Extraction Framework (VDEF) links from VistA sites are updated to send data to eMI, the support for accepting VistA data through Vitria Interface Engine (VIE) and Socket Adapter will be phased out. Home Telehealth (HTH) clients will continue to send data to HDR through the Socket Adapter.
Revision Version
Submitted By
Submission Date
Certified
Notes
13
OIT EPMO EPMD ACOE Tools Operations Open Source Service
08-07-2018
Adding updated Code and Docs
v3.20
OIT EPMO EPMD ACOE Tools Operations Open Source Service
04-23-2018
This revision makes available the source code for HDR II v3.20 which is currently under development.
11
OIT EPMO EPMD ACOE Tools Operations Open Source Service
01-28-2018
Adding updated code and docs.
10
OIT EPMO EPMD ACOE Tools Operations Open Source Service
01-28-2018
Adding updated code and docs.
9
OIT EPMO EPMD ACOE Tools Operations Open Source Service
12-06-2017
Adding updated code and docs.
8
OIT EPMO EPMD ACOE Tools Operations Open Source Service
09-23-2017
Adding updated code and docs.
7
OIT EPMO EPMD ACOE Tools Operations Open Source Service
09-23-2017
Adding updated code and docs.
6
OIT EPMO EPMD ACOE Tools Operations Open Source Service
09-23-2017
Adding updated code and docs.
5
OIT EPMO EPMD ACOE Tools Operations Open Source Service
06-25-2017
Adding updated code and docs
4
OIT EPMO EPMD ACOE Tools Operations Open Source Service
03-22-2017
This revision makes available the in-flight source code for HDR v3.16 Iteration 1
3
OIT EPMO EPMD ACOE Tools Operations Open Source Service
12-13-2016
This revision makes available the v3.15 Iteration 2 source which is an update to the iteration 1 source submitted in November.
2
OIT EPMO EPMD ACOE Tools Operations Open Source Service
11-15-2016
This revision makes available the in-flight code and SDD for HDR II v3.15 Iteration 1.
1
OIT EPMO EPMD ACOE Tools Operations Open Source Service
08-17-2016
Reviews (Phase: Peer)
There is no review at this time. To submit one, please log in.
COMMENTS